首页
/ 打造Zotero全平台高效工作流:跨设备协作的笔记同步解决方案

打造Zotero全平台高效工作流:跨设备协作的笔记同步解决方案

2026-04-27 11:34:28作者:彭桢灵Jeremy

在多设备办公时代,研究人员和知识工作者常面临笔记分散、版本混乱的痛点。本文将系统介绍如何利用Zotero-Better-Notes构建跨设备协作的知识管理系统,实现学术笔记在电脑、平板与手机间的无缝流转,让知识创作突破设备限制。

诊断知识管理痛点

现代研究工作中,知识工作者普遍面临三大挑战:多设备间笔记同步延迟、手动传输导致的版本冲突、以及跨平台格式兼容性问题。这些问题直接影响研究效率,甚至造成重要数据丢失。

传统解决方案如云端文档虽能解决部分同步问题,但缺乏与文献管理的深度整合,导致学术研究中的引用、批注与笔记分离存储。Zotero-Better-Notes通过将笔记系统与文献管理深度融合,为学术工作流提供了一体化解决方案。

构建同步架构

Zotero-Better-Notes的核心价值在于其分布式同步引擎,该引擎通过三层架构实现跨设备知识管理:

graph TD
    A[本地笔记库] -->|变更检测| B[同步引擎]
    B -->|加密传输| C[中央存储]
    C -->|冲突解决| D[多设备同步]
    D -->|实时更新| A

核心技术特性

  • 增量同步算法:仅传输变更内容,减少带宽占用
  • 分布式锁机制:防止多设备同时编辑导致的冲突
  • 版本控制引擎:保留笔记修改历史,支持回溯
  • 元数据整合:将笔记与Zotero文献库元数据深度关联

Zotero-Better-Notes工作区界面展示 Zotero-Better-Notes全功能界面,包含笔记编辑区、知识图谱和关联文献面板

部署全平台同步系统

环境准备与安装

  1. 克隆项目仓库

    git clone https://gitcode.com/gh_mirrors/zo/zotero-better-notes
    cd zotero-better-notes
    
  2. 安装依赖并构建

    npm install   # 安装构建依赖
    npm run build # 编译插件文件
    
  3. 安装到Zotero

    • 打开Zotero,进入工具 > 插件
    • 点击齿轮图标,选择从文件安装插件
    • 选择构建生成的.xpi文件
    • ⌨️ 快捷键: Ctrl+Shift+P (Windows/Linux) 或 Cmd+Shift+P (Mac) 快速打开插件面板

💡 实操提示:确保Zotero版本≥6.0,旧版本可能导致插件功能异常。安装完成后需重启Zotero生效。

配置同步环境

  1. 初始化同步目录

    • 打开Better Notes > 设置 > 同步
    • 点击选择同步目录,指定本地文件夹
    • 启用自动同步选项,设置同步频率
  2. 多设备连接

    • 在其他设备上重复上述安装步骤
    • 确保所有设备指向同一同步目录(可通过云存储实现)
    • 点击同步管理器验证设备连接状态

💡 实操提示:推荐使用支持实时同步的云存储(如Syncthing、Dropbox)作为同步介质,确保文件变更能被及时检测。

:::warning 注意事项 同步目录必须具有读写权限,网络存储路径可能导致同步延迟。首次同步大型笔记库时,建议在稳定网络环境下进行。 :::

解决跨设备协作挑战

同步冲突处理

当多设备同时编辑同一笔记时,系统会触发冲突检测机制:

  1. 自动打开同步差异对比界面
  2. 左侧显示本地版本,右侧显示远程版本
  3. 通过复选框选择需要保留的内容
  4. 点击合并并解决完成冲突处理
故障排除:同步失败

常见同步失败原因及解决方案:

  1. 权限问题

    • 检查同步目录权限设置
    • 运行命令验证访问权限:
      ls -ld /path/to/sync/directory
      
  2. 文件锁定

    • 关闭所有设备上打开的相关笔记
    • 删除同步目录中的.lock文件
  3. 网络问题

    • 验证云存储同步状态
    • 手动触发同步:Better Notes > 同步 > 立即同步

数据一致性保障

为确保跨设备数据一致性,系统实现了多重校验机制:

  • 内容哈希校验:通过SHA-256算法验证文件完整性
  • 元数据同步:笔记关联的文献引用独立同步
  • 冲突日志:自动记录所有冲突解决历史

知识整合架构图 Zotero-Better-Notes知识整合架构,展示笔记与文献的关联网络

优化全平台工作流

构建高效同步策略

根据不同使用场景,可采用以下同步策略:

  1. 学术项目分组

    • 按研究主题创建独立同步目录
    • 通过标签筛选实现项目级同步管理
  2. 设备角色分工

    • 台式机:主要编辑设备,开启完整同步
    • 平板:阅读设备,仅同步近期笔记
    • 手机:轻量访问,仅同步核心摘要

:::tip 优化建议 使用同步排除规则功能,将大型附件(如PDF)排除在自动同步范围外,手动管理大型文件传输。 :::

自动化工作流配置

通过以下步骤实现同步流程自动化:

  1. 设置定时同步:设置 > 同步 > 定时同步,建议设为每30分钟
  2. 配置同步完成通知:设置 > 通知 > 同步完成
  3. 启用自动备份:设置 > 备份 > 自动备份,保留最近10个版本

⌨️ 快捷键Alt+S快速打开同步面板,Ctrl+Shift+S强制同步所有笔记

拓展应用场景

团队协作模式

Zotero-Better-Notes的同步功能可扩展至小型研究团队:

  1. 创建共享同步目录
  2. 设置团队成员权限分级
  3. 启用变更通知与审核机制
  4. 通过版本历史追踪团队贡献

跨平台知识整合

将同步系统与其他学术工具集成:

  • LaTeX工作流:同步Markdown笔记至LaTeX项目
  • 引用管理:自动更新笔记中的文献引用格式
  • 知识图谱:基于同步数据构建研究领域知识网络

进阶技巧

功能 实现方法 应用场景
选择性同步 在同步管理器中勾选需要同步的笔记 节省移动设备存储空间
离线工作模式 提前同步所需笔记,断开网络后编辑 无网络环境下工作
同步日志分析 查看sync.log识别同步瓶颈 优化大型笔记库同步性能
命令行同步 使用zotero-cli sync命令 集成到自动化脚本

通过上述配置与优化,Zotero-Better-Notes将成为跨设备学术研究的核心枢纽,让知识创作突破设备限制,实现无缝的全平台工作流体验。无论是个人研究还是团队协作,这套同步解决方案都能显著提升知识管理效率,让研究者专注于创意本身而非技术细节。

随着学术研究的数字化转型,构建高效的跨设备工作流已成为提升研究效率的关键。Zotero-Better-Notes通过其灵活的同步架构和深度的文献整合能力,为现代学术工作者提供了一个强大的知识管理平台,值得在研究实践中深入应用和探索。

登录后查看全文
热门项目推荐
相关项目推荐

项目优选

收起
atomcodeatomcode
Claude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get Started
Rust
444
78
docsdocs
暂无描述
Dockerfile
691
4.47 K
kernelkernel
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
408
327
pytorchpytorch
Ascend Extension for PyTorch
Python
550
673
kernelkernel
deepin linux kernel
C
28
16
RuoYi-Vue3RuoYi-Vue3
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
1.59 K
930
ops-mathops-math
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
955
931
communitycommunity
本项目是CANN开源社区的核心管理仓库,包含社区的治理章程、治理组织、通用操作指引及流程规范等基础信息
650
232
openHiTLSopenHiTLS
旨在打造算法先进、性能卓越、高效敏捷、安全可靠的密码套件,通过轻量级、可剪裁的软件技术架构满足各行业不同场景的多样化要求,让密码技术应用更简单,同时探索后量子等先进算法创新实践,构建密码前沿技术底座!
C
1.08 K
564
Cangjie-ExamplesCangjie-Examples
本仓将收集和展示高质量的仓颉示例代码,欢迎大家投稿,让全世界看到您的妙趣设计,也让更多人通过您的编码理解和喜爱仓颉语言。
C
436
4.43 K